EROZA-SOLANA, Enrique y CARRASCO-GOMEZ, Mónica. Intercultural Health: Reflections from Experience. LiminaR [online]. 2020, vol.18, n.1, pp.112-128. Epub 15-Mayo-2020. ISSN 2007-8900. https://doi.org/10.29043/liminar.v18i1.725.
Unlike what is generally assumed in theories and practices regarding intercultural health, which is limited to discussing the coexistence of allopathic and indigenous medicine, our own experience has revealed sociocultural dimensions that at the macro and the micro levels intervene in this relationship. These dimensions involve a wide variety of social actors who give intercultural health a life of its own, while accounting for the challenge of solving health problems among ethnic minorities. Based on these reflections, we emphasize the relevance of conducting long-term studies to deepen, document, and understand the meaning of health practices among indigenous peoples, in terms of their relationship with the wider nature of their culture, social life, and history. This, we believe, is the path to establishing a true intercultural dialogue in health.
